Empower completes shoring work at Business Bay plant

Emirates Central Cooling Systems Corporation (Empower) has announced that it has completed the shoring work for its fourth district cooling plant in Business Bay, Dubai, being built at a total investment of AED250 million ($68 million).
 
Characterized by leading standards in energy production and environmental design, the new plant is situated in a strategic location close to Al Khail Road and on completion, will boast a cooling capacity of 50,000 refrigeration tons (RT). 
 
The new Business Bay plant is the pick of the progress achieved by Empower in district cooling industry, thanks to the optimal utilization of leading operating standards that contribute to reducing cooling energy consumption, the sustainable solutions in the use of treated sewage effluent, and a standard distribution technology that guarantees high reliable service, it stated. 
 
It is connected to a robust distribution network that reflects the company’s readiness to provide quality services and meet the actual new demand, in accordance with the well-measured expectations of the needs and requirements of urban expansion in Dubai, said a statement from the company.
 
"Empower is currently providing district cooling services from three plants in Business Bay with a total cooling capacity of 135,000 RT," said its CEO Ahmad Bin Shafar.
